MAC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2022 in Review

292 of the 5,936 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Macerich (MAC) for Q2 2022, worth a combined $1.57B — down 46% from $2.9B a quarter earlier.

Sellers outnumbered buyers: 43 funds closed out of MAC and 35 opened new positions — a net loss of 8 holders — while 101 trimmed existing stakes and 115 added.

The largest buyer was Morgan Stanley, adding an estimated $19.4M. The largest seller was AEW Capital Management, exiting entirely with an estimated $71.1M sold.
